Optimal Choice of Radiotherapy in Locally Advanced, Low Rectal Cancer: A Propensity Matched Analysis Comparing

Summary
Short-course radiation therapy (SCRT) offers similar oncological outcomes to long-course chemoradiation (LCRT) for low rectal cancer. However, LCRT may be preferred for clinical T4 tumors, showing better disease-free survival.

Background:
- Low rectal cancer treatment involves neoadjuvant radiation followed by surgery.
- Short-course radiation therapy (SCRT) and long-course chemoradiation (LCRT) are established treatment modalities.
- Total mesorectal excision (TME) is a key surgical technique, with extended resections employed when necessary.
Purpose of the Study:
- To compare oncological outcomes of SCRT versus LCRT in low rectal cancer patients.
- To evaluate treatment efficacy in a high-volume center with expertise in extended TME.
- To identify potential differences in survival, recurrence, and response rates between SCRT and LCRT.
Main Methods:
- Retrospective, propensity-matched study of low rectal cancer patients (≤5 cm from anal verge).
- Inclusion of patients who received neoadjuvant SCRT (25 Gy/5 fractions) or LCRT (50-50.4 Gy/25-28 fractions) followed by TME.
- Exclusion of patients with metastatic disease or prior pelvic radiation; propensity score matching performed on key clinical variables.
Main Results:
- After matching, 466 LCRT and 157 SCRT patients were analyzed.
- Three-year disease-free survival (DFS) and overall survival (OS) were similar between SCRT and LCRT groups (64% vs. 62% DFS, p=0.8).
- No significant differences observed in local recurrence-free survival, pathological complete response (18% vs. 20%), or CRM positivity (6.4% vs. 10%). Clinical T4 tumors showed significantly lower 2-year DFS with SCRT (41.2% vs. 58.7%, p=0.03).
Conclusions:
- SCRT demonstrates comparable oncological outcomes to LCRT in appropriately selected low rectal cancer patients.
- LCRT may be a more effective option for patients with clinical T4 low rectal tumors, associated with better DFS.
- The choice between SCRT and LCRT should consider tumor stage and patient selection for optimal outcomes.
